Monaco is set to enhance its festive offerings with the introduction of a new Sports Village, opening on Friday, December 20, 2024, at 11:00 AM on the southern quay of Port Hercule. This addition aims to complement the already popular ‘Gingerbread & Delicacies’ Christmas Village, broadening the array of activities available during the holiday season.
Designed to cater to enthusiasts of all ages, the Sports Village will feature a variety of attractions, including three obstacle courses inspired by the popular ‘Ninja Warrior’ TV show, a treetop adventure course, a climbing wall, and a thrilling 180-meter zipline. These activities are accessible to individuals starting from the age of three, ensuring a family-friendly environment where everyone can participate.
The Sports Village will welcome visitors until Sunday, January 5, providing ample opportunity for both locals and tourists to experience this unique adrenaline-packed zone.
